6 new tribunal suspects likely: sources
BY Cat Barton

SIX more potential candidates for prosecution have been identified by 
Cambodia's war crimes tribunal, sources close to the UN-backed court say.
The court's international co-prosecutor Robert Petit, who proposed the 
investigations, would not confirm the number or names of the potential suspects 
citing legal reasons, but said the possibility of more cases should come as no 
surprise.
"There's always been a higher number than five accused discussed during and 
after the negotiations," he said in an interview Monday. "Those new cases 
represent, as far as I'm concerned, the extent of which the prosecution will 
be," Petit added.
Sources close to the court say three more cases are expected - two new and one 
supplementary - involving six additional suspects.
Petit's Cambodian counterpart, Chea Leang, has refused to sign off on the 
second submission, prompting Petit to lodge a "statement of disagreement". The 
court's pretrial chamber must now resolve the impasse, which threatens to 
further delay the trials.
Chea Leang repeatedly declined comment Tuesday, saying she was "too busy".
The court's internal rules say she must respond to Petit's submission this week.
Observers have urged the Cambodian side of the court to demonstrate its 
independence by allowing further investigations to begin.
"If ever there was a moment to show that the Court is not a tool of the 
Cambodian government, this is it," Open Society Justice Initiative's executive 
director, James Goldston, wrote in an email.
